thoughts don’t need a focus
that’s why books blur

people are something else too
(moment of 0 confidence)

as the world gets scarier
so must our mirrors

feruled thighs are purpling
in the bruise of 1:12am regret

a boy simulates rape
in the vestiges of a saint’s old pew

and i reflect fear

as an ocean floor projects waves

as a cloud neglects the morning light
